The Science Behind the Spin: RNG and Fairness
Randomness is the lifeblood of any casino game. Without it, the house edge would be meaningless, and players would quickly catch on to predictable patterns. RNGs simulate randomness through complex mathematical formulas, but don’t be fooled—these are not just dice rolls in digital form. They are carefully audited and tested to prevent manipulation.
While some skeptics might suspect rigged outcomes, the reality is that regulatory bodies impose strict standards. Developers must comply with these to maintain licenses and player trust. Balancing Act: House Edge vs Player Experience
Every casino game walks a tightrope between profitability and entertainment. The house edge ensures the casino stays afloat, but if it’s too steep, players won’t stick around. Developers tweak payout percentages and volatility to strike a balance that keeps the game engaging without turning it into a losing proposition from the first spin.
- Low volatility: Frequent small wins, less risk, longer playtime.
- High volatility: Rare big wins, higher risk, adrenaline rush.
- Medium volatility: A mix of both, appealing to a broad audience.

Programming Languages and Platforms
Behind every game lies a stack of code written in languages like C++, JavaScript, or HTML5. The choice depends on the target platform—desktop, mobile, or both. HTML5 has become the darling of developers because it allows seamless play across devices without the need for additional plugins.
| Technology | Purpose | Advantages | Drawbacks |
|---|---|---|---|
| C++ | Core game engine development | High performance, control over hardware | Steeper learning curve, longer development time |
| HTML5 | Cross-platform compatibility | Runs on browsers, mobile-friendly | Limited access to device hardware |
| JavaScript | Interactive front-end features | Dynamic content, easy integration | Performance limitations for complex logic |
| Unity | 3D game development | Rich graphics, multiplatform support | Requires more resources, larger file sizes |
Regulations and Compliance: The Invisible Hand
Developers can’t just whip up a game and toss it into the wild. Licensing authorities demand rigorous testing and certification to protect players and ensure fairness. This layer of bureaucracy might seem like a buzzkill, but it’s essential for maintaining industry integrity.
Some might argue that these regulations slow innovation, but they also prevent the wild west scenario where shady operators run amok. The balance between creativity and compliance is a constant negotiation, shaping how games evolve.
